At the Green Municipal Fund (GMF), we create change where it matters most—in Canada’s municipalities. As the Federation of Canadian Municipalities’ flagship program and backed by a $2.4 billion endowment from the Government of Canada, GMF helps Canadian municipalities, big and small, invest in their future by supporting homegrown sustainability and resilience projects that work for Canadians by creating jobs, lowering costs, and strengthening local economies. Through our unique mix of funding, resources and training, GMF is enhancing the quality of life for people in Canada by accelerating a transformation to sustainable and resilient communities. Since 2000, GMF has invested over $1.6 billion in local projects helping communities avoid 2.9 million tonnes of greenhouse gas emissions, while also contributing $1.24 billion to the national GDP and creating more than 13,000 person-years of national employment. |

Reporting to the Manager- Client Support Services, the Data Coordinator is responsible for providing operational and analytical support to the Green Municipal Fund’s Client Services, Funding and Investments unit. Key functions of this role include supporting the unit’s operational and financial reporting, including annual reporting and requests for data analysis for strategic or auditing purposes. Tasks include training and onboarding new staff to the CRM, developing new dashboards with the goals of enhancing business intelligence for data-informed decision making, ensuring data mapping is up-to-date and traceable to critical fields in the CRM and linked to auditing and reporting requirements, supporting the analysis for the preparation of recommendations for funding presented to GMF council and working on continuous improvement projects related to data governance. As an active member of GMF’s CSFI unit, the incumbent will take part in various departmental initiatives and support FCM’s overall role as a national leading municipal association aimed at strengthening local capacities and enhancing governance. The Data Coordinator supports the development and delivery of data visualizations and key performance indicators results through data mining and reconciliation, research of new opportunities and tools in data management, and review and analysis of unit reports. |
